How To Make Frozen Hot Chocolate

Ingredients

  • Hot Chocolate or Hot Cocoa
  • Frozen Yogurt or Ice Cream
  • Vanilla Extract
  • Gingerbread Spices*
  • Whipped Cream
  • Chocolate Shavings
  • Mini Gingerbread Cookies

* You can make your own Gingerbread Spice Mix at home and add it to all sorts of things over the festive season!

You can also substitute the ice cream/frozen yogurt and the whipped cream for dairy free alternatives if you wanted to make a dairy-free frozen hot chocolate instead.

Description

Indulge in a festive treat with this frozen hot chocolate! A delicious blend of rich chocolate, warm gingerbread spices, and a frosty twist, perfect for holiday sipping. Easy to make and perfect for kids and adults alike!


Ingredients

  • 3 cups hot chocolate or hot cocoa, cooled
  • 3 scoops vanilla frozen yogurt or ice cream
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• ¼ tsp nutmeg
  • ½ tsp ground ginger
  • ½ tsp ground cinnamon
  •  
  • optional: cream and chocolate shavings to top

Instructions

  1. Place all the ingredients in a blender and blitz until well combined. Top with cream and chocolate shavings and serve immediately.
